A virtual workplace (DaaS or VDI) is a deployed operating system with the necessary software on the provider's side that allows employees to work without the need for desktop PCs. To organize a workplace for an employee, only a monitor, information input means (mouse and keyboard), any equipment (current PCs, old PCs of low power, special clients that are much cheaper than PCs) and Internet access will be needed. With this approach, the employee will not notice the difference during work, and we will describe the meaning of such changes for the organization below..
This solution is flexible and suitable for companies of all sizes.
The main advantage for large and medium-sized companies is cost reduction. In our experience, after switching to VDI, costs are reduced by 35-40%.
The main advantage for small companies is the reliability of the solution and fast support. Usually small companies do not have backup equipment and the failure of even one workplace is causing problems. It becomes necessary to call third-party specialists to solve the problem, and in some cases this results in expensive repairs. With VDI, there cannot be such a problem, since all operations and data storage are carried out on the side of the provider.
